Prosecutors Say More Charges Against Martin Shkreli Likely

Move would relate to former pharma executive’s alleged fraud against drug company Retrophin

By CHRISTOPHER M. MATTHEWS
Updated May 3, 2016 2:53 p.m. ET

Prosecutors are likely to file additional charges against former pharmaceutical executive Martin Shkreli and his onetime lawyer Evan Greebel, prosecutors have told defense lawyers.

Lawyers for. Messrs. Shkreli and Greebel, who were arrested on fraud charges last year, told a federal judge on Tuesday that prosecutors informed them of the possible new charges in a recent meeting.

Assistant U.S. Attorney Winston Paes confirmed during the hearing the government is considering filing new charges related to the pair’s alleged defrauding of pharmaceutical company Retrophin Inc., where Mr. Shkreli was previously chief executive.

Prosecutors will make a final decision on filing a new indictment within the month, Mr. Paes said during the hearing in Brooklyn federal court on Tuesday.
